dev: обновление настроек больше не вызывает проблем, если не выбран режим работы
This commit is contained in:
parent
05177a90b9
commit
de49e50c83
Binary file not shown.
Binary file not shown.
@ -277,14 +277,17 @@ class MainWindow(BaseMainWindow):
|
|||||||
self.note_label.adjustSize()
|
self.note_label.adjustSize()
|
||||||
|
|
||||||
def _transfer_settings(self) -> None:
|
def _transfer_settings(self) -> None:
|
||||||
self.tabWidget.clear()
|
|
||||||
operator_params = self.operSettings.getParams()
|
operator_params = self.operSettings.getParams()
|
||||||
system_params = self.sysSettings.getParams()
|
system_params = self.sysSettings.getParams()
|
||||||
self._controller.update_settings([operator_params, system_params])
|
self._controller.update_settings([operator_params, system_params])
|
||||||
|
|
||||||
def _upd_settings(self) -> None:
|
def _upd_settings(self) -> None:
|
||||||
self._transfer_settings()
|
self._transfer_settings()
|
||||||
self._controller.update_plots()
|
if self.mode_label.text():
|
||||||
|
self.tabWidget.clear()
|
||||||
|
self._controller.update_plots()
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
def _close_tab(self, index:int) -> None:
|
def _close_tab(self, index:int) -> None:
|
||||||
self.tabWidget.removeTab(index)
|
self.tabWidget.removeTab(index)
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user